🔌 The SkyRC NC3000 Octa is a professional charger and analyzer for AA and AAA NiMH/NiCD batteries, designed for demanding users. With its 8 independent slots, it allows you to charge, discharge, and analyze each battery separately. Its 65W USB-C Power Delivery power supply, adjustable current up to 3A per cell, and Bluetooth connection with the SkyCharger app make it an ideal tool for RC pilots and modelers.

⚙️ Technical specifications

  • Smart battery charger/analyzer
  • NiMH/NiCD compatible
  • AA/AAA formats
  • 8 independent slots with individual control
  • Adjustable charging current from 0.2A to 3.0A
  • Discharge current up to 2.5A
  • Charge, discharge, refresh, and analysis functions
  • Bluetooth with SkyCharger app
  • TN screen

SKYRC NC3000 OCTA

"Electronique hyper complète pour les utilisateurs les plus exigeants. Plages de réglages complètes et étendues pour toute opération. Par contre la mécanique d'insertion et d'extraction est beaucoup trop serrante en longueur des accus. Pas de ressort mais des pattes métalliques coudées très rigides. Pour éviter d'abîmer l'isolant des accus (côté -) sur le long terme, il est nécessaire de les insérer côté - en premier et de les retirer côté + en premier. L'extraction demande beaucoup de précautions."
